The Wyoming Secretary of State’s office delivers an online entity search tool that allows individuals and companies to search for recorded entities within the state. This tool is essential for prospective company principals who want to ensure their desired company name is available and to verify the status of existing companies. The entity search can be accessed through the Secretary of State’s official website, where stakeholders can input various search criteria, including business name, filing search business number, or registered agent information.

Conducting an entity search is a critical first step in the enterprise formation process. It helps entrepreneurs avoid potential legal issues that may arise from choosing a name that is already in use or too similar to an existing entity. In Wyoming, business names must be unique and distinguishable from other recorded entities to prevent confusion in the marketplace. The entity search not only aids in name availability checks but also offers important details about existing companies, such as their status, formation date, and registered agent.

Before delving into the specifics of LLC entity search resources, it’s important to understand what an LLC is. A Limited Liability Company is a company structure that combines the flexibility of a partnership with the liability protection typically associated with corporations. LLCs are popular among small enterprise owners because they offer personal liability protection, meaning that the principals’ personal assets are generally shielded from business debts and lawsuits. Additionally, LLCs benefit from pass-through taxation, allowing profits and losses to be reported on the principals' personal tax returns, thereby avoiding double taxation.
